#300cba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#300cba is composed of 18.8% red, 4.7% green and 72.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.2% cyan, 93.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 252.4 degrees, a saturation of 87.9% and a lightness of 38.8%. #300cba color hex could be obtained by blending #6018ff with #000075.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

Shades and Tints of #300cba

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000002 is the darkest color, while #f2eef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#300cba

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#616066 is the less saturated color, while #2c04c2 is the most saturated one.
